GithubHelp home page GithubHelp logo

arthurticianeli / entrega-construa-um-jogo-de-azar-sprint-3-arthurticianeli Goto Github PK

View Code? Open in Web Editor NEW
0.0 0.0 0.0 14 KB

entrega-construa-um-jogo-de-azar-sprint-3-arthurticianeli created by GitHub Classroom

HTML 34.46% JavaScript 26.54% CSS 39.00%

entrega-construa-um-jogo-de-azar-sprint-3-arthurticianeli's Introduction

Entrega: Construa um Jogo de Azar

Primeiro, faça o clone desse repositório.

Implemente pelo menos um dos seguintes jogos usando HTML, CSS e JavaScript. Este será um projeto que você colocará em seu portfólio, então faça-o bonito e use a função do GitLab Pages para hospedar o jogo concluído para que qualquer um possa jogar.

Todos estes jogos irão precisar gerar números aleatórios, conforme a atividade de rolagem de dados desta sprint.

A grosso modo, aqueles que aparecem antes na lista são mais fáceis que os que aparecem depois (sujeito a variação de acordo com sua experiência).

Se estiver procurando desafios extras, você pode "aperfeiçoar" qualquer um desses jogos ao adicionar efeitos e animações de sobreposição de mouse.

Pedra, Papel e Tesoura

Homem contra Máquina! Teste suas habilidades de Pedra, Papel e Tesoura contra o computador:

  • O usuário faz uma escolha
  • O computador faz uma escolha aleatória
  • A função de comparação determina quem ganha

Magic 8-Ball

Concentre-se em uma pergunta de Sim / Não que você precisa muito da resposta e clique na Bola 8 Mágica para saber seu destino.

Leia: Magic 8-Ball Dica: A sentença switch pode ser muito útil aqui!

Faça o push do código para o seu repositório GitHub e implemente-o GitHub pages. No Canvas, por favor, envie sua url do GitHub Pages: (ex: https://nomedeusuario.github.io/katas2) e envie o link do seu repositório nos comentários. Após ser a correção, seu projeto deverá ficar privado.

Máquina Caça-Níquel

Puxe a alavanca da máquina caça-níquel e faça uma fortuna se conseguir 3 símbolos iguais!

Exemplos: Veja esta máquina caça-níquel em Javascript e como construi-la ou então veja este outro exemplo (todos em inglês). Estes são apenas exemplos; você deve criar os próprios códigos.

Caça-palavras

Defina um array de 20 palavras com menos de 10 letras cada. Escreva um programa que colocará 3 palavras aleatórias horizontalmente em uma matriz de 10x10 letras. Então gere letras aleatórias para camuflar as palavras. Desafie seus amigos a encontrá-las!

Leia: Word Search

Desafio: depois de concluir a implementação básica, que tal adicionar alguns detalhes:

  • Posicione algumas palavras verticalmente
  • Posicione algumas palavras diagonalmente
  • Torne-o interativo! Deixe o usuário marcar as palavras enquanto joga
  • Limite o tempo disponível com um temporizador!

Envio

Faça o push do código para o seu repositório GitHub e implemente-o GitHub pages. No Canvas, por favor, envie sua url do GitHub Pages: (ex: https://nomedeusuario.github.io/game-of-chance) e envie o link do seu repositório nos comentários. Após ser a correção, seu projeto deverá ficar privado.

entrega-construa-um-jogo-de-azar-sprint-3-arthurticianeli's People

Contributors

arthurticianeli avatar github-classroom[bot] av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.